Location
Sprowston is a suburban area located to the north of Norwich, in Norfolk. It is a predominantly residential area that has grown in recent years, blending modern housing developments with a mix of older properties. Known for its proximity to the city of Norwich, Sprowston offers easy access to the city's amenities while retaining a more peaceful, suburban feel. The area is well-connected by road, with the A1042 and the A140 running nearby, making it convenient for commuters. Sprowston is also home to several green spaces, parks, and recreational areas, making it an attractive place for growing families. Additionally, the community has access to local schools, shops, and services, contributing to its appeal as a desirable place to live.
